Alfa Insurance, a well-known provider of various insurance products, often raises questions about its availability, particularly whether it is exclusively offered to Alabama residents. While Alfa Insurance has strong roots in Alabama, where it was founded and maintains a significant presence, its services are not limited to residents of that state alone. The company has expanded its reach to several other states in the southeastern United States, offering policies for auto, home, life, and other types of insurance. However, the specific availability of Alfa Insurance products can vary by state, so it’s essential for potential customers to verify coverage options in their respective areas. This expansion beyond Alabama reflects Alfa’s commitment to serving a broader customer base while maintaining its regional focus.

One unique aspect of Alfa Insurance is its focus on serving rural and agricultural communities. The company’s farm insurance policies cater specifically to farmers and landowners, offering coverage for crops, livestock, and equipment. Eligibility for these specialized policies often requires proof of agricultural operations, such as land ownership or farming income. This niche focus sets Alfa apart from competitors and underscores its commitment to supporting rural economies.
